a'Time', 'Year', 'Month', 'Date' appears on the TV screen
Normally the date and time are taken from the data sent by the TV
channel stored on programme P01. If th aerial signal is too weak or there
is excessive interference, you should set the dateand time manually:
1Check if the time in 'Time' is correct.
2If required, change the time with the number buttons 0..9on your
remote control.
3Select the next line with CH+ Aor CH- B.
4Check if the displayed settings for 'Year', 'Month' and 'Date' are
correct.
5When all information is correct, save by pressing OK.Problem

aI can see more installation menus on my TV set
Not all the necessary data has been transferred. Please enter the settings
by hand as follows. For more information on the various functions see
'Initial installation' in 'Installing your DVD recorder'.
1Select the desired audio language using CH- Bor CH+ Aand confirm
with OK.
2Select the desired subtitle language with CH- Bor CH+ Aand
confirm with OK .
3Select the desired screen format position using CH-Bor CH+A.
'4:3 letterbox' Fora 4:3 TV set; cinema format (black bars above and
belowthe picture)
'4:3 panscan' For a 4:3 TV set; full height format with the sides cut
off
'16:9' Fora 16:9 TV set
4Confirm with OK .
5Select the country of your residence with CH-Bor CH+A.
If your country does not appear, select 'Other'.
6Confirm with OK .Problem
Initial installation is now complete.
